Windrush - Jayanti's Pawns by Malcolm Archibald
Jack Windrush is still in India during the late stages of the Indian Mutiny.
Tired of war, he has to obey orders when Colonel Hook orders him to hunt down a mysterious female warrior named Jayanti. Soon, Jack's company of the 113th Foot shares in the defeat at Fort Ruhya, where they encounter warriors wearing black turbans... and discover that they are women.
With a Pathan prisoner, Jack and the remains of the 113th Foot leave the main army to search for Jayanti.
Amid ferocious battle, betrayal and a personal game of cat and mouse with Jayanti herself, Jack and his company move ever closer to the final confrontation in their campaign.
Malcolm Archibald has worked as everything from a postman to a college lecturer. Scottish Wars, Mother Law, which came in second place in the inaugural Dundee Book Award, Whales for the Wizard, which received the Dundee Book Prize, and The Darkest Walk, which won the People's Book Prize, are among his works.
